Tullycarnet Park is in east Belfast. The park has a children's playground. We have installed public access defibrillators for park users.
Getting to Tullycarnet Park
Entrance to the park is off the Gilnahirk Road. If you are travelling by bus, take Metro no.18-19 from Belfast city centre.
Green Flag awards
Tullycarnet Park was awarded a Green Flag Award in 2017, 2018, 2019 and 2020. This award recognises the best open spaces in the UK.
ParkLife Saturday Club at Tullycarnet Park
ParkLife is a fun, free educational programme to encourage children and their families to become more active and involved in outdoor activities in parks and open spaces in Belfast.
This project is run by Belfast City Council in partnership with Ulster Wildlife, aiming to increase children’s interaction with nature at their local park. ParkLife is open to children between the ages of seven and twelve. Children under seven are welcome but must be accompanied by an adult.
